You can easily configure a custom key shortcut to open the "Quick Note" window with a keyboard shortcut. If you really want to run this with a drag-from-edge gesture, I think you can configure a drag gesture with LibInput-Gestures, but I have never tried this for myself.

Notable might also be a good alternative -- it stores notes in standard Markdown, so there's no lock-in, but it displays inline images and has a lot of similar features to Obsidian.
